In this week’s episode of The Podcast Trapper, I discuss something that I hope you’re super familiar with…Podcast listener reports.

If you don’t know about these yet, welcome to the wonderful world of podcast listener data. These stats have great power to us podcast creators. The problem is, these stats are usually…pretty vague. They discuss “podcast listeners” or even “women listeners,” but there is not much detail into which women are tuning in! I know many of us would love to know whether black women, nonbinary people, asian or latina women are consuming your content, right?!

This is important information to us creators, because our culture affects how we listen to content.

Today I’ll be sharing WHY podcast listener data affects your podcast strategy, HOW it could be more diverse and WHAT we can do about it.
